We are currently looking for an experienced Mechanical Commissioning Engineer to support a major project at Bournemouth Hospital, working for a leading Tier 1 contractor. This is a long-term temporary opportunity with at least 12 months of work available, and a strong pipeline of ongoing works in the Bournemouth area.

Role Overview

You will be responsible for the commissioning of mechanical building services on a large healthcare project, ensuring systems are delivered safely, compliantly, and to programme. The role requires a strong mechanical bias and experience working on complex, live environments.

Key Requirements

  • Proven experience as a Mechanical Commissioning Engineer
  • Strong background in healthcare or large-scale commercial projects
  • Ability to work within a Tier 1 contractor environment
  • Solid understanding of commissioning procedures, testing, and documentation
  • Reliable, proactive, and able to work independently on site

Contract Details

  • Location: Bournemouth Hospital
  • Duration: Minimum 12 months
  • Rate: £300 - £400 per day, depending on experience
  • Start: ASAP / by agreement
